On Wed, Jul 09, 2025 at 07:47:43PM +0200, Eugenio Pérez wrote:
As it is the only function using it. I'm always confusing it with tcp_l2_iov, moving it here avoids it.
Signed-off-by: Eugenio Pérez
I like making it local, I'd question whether it even needs to remain 'static'.
Probably not, I was just worried about a stack overflow. But I didn't measure its size to be honest.
